> 20191226:
> +	Clang/LLVM is now the default compiler for all powerpc architectures.
> +	LLD is now the default linker for powerpc64.  The change for powerpc64
> +	also includes a change to the ELFv2 ABI, incompatible with the existing
> +	ABI.
